Nakheel completes design of Palm Deira bridges

by ArabianBusiness.com staff writer  on Sunday, 16 November 2008

Nakheel has announced the completion of designs for three 12-lane bridges that will connect the Palm Deira with mainland Deira.

Construction on the first bridge, to be 1,000 meters long and 15 meters tall, has already begun. Excavation work on the second bridge, also 1,000 meters is said to be in progress.

Commenting on the US$544.4 million project, Abdulla Bin Sulayem, Operations Director of Palm Deira, said: "We congratulate Parsons Group on completing design work on the Palm Deira bridges to the highest specifications.
